Last night Edwin Encarnacion signed with Cleveland for what looks like at least $65 million in guaranteed money over three years. Whatever interest the Cardinals had in Encarnacion seemed to fizzle pretty quickly and most reports leading up to the signing indicated that only American League clubs were bidding high. Read into that what you will, but a few hours before the news broke VEB’s Ben Markham explained why he felt Encarnacion would be a bad fit for the Cardinals. Since the club was unwilling to outbid Cleveland they must have agreed.
